Western Avenue Principal Prosen headed for Oak Brook school
Western Avenue School Principal Chad Prosen resigned this week. He will become the new principal at Brook Forest School in Butler District 53 in Oak Brook beginning with the 2017-18 school year. The District 53 school board approved Prosen’s hiring on May 8.

New Parker Junior High principal named after three-month search
A new principal is coming to Parker Junior High School in Flossmoor. When the District 161 Board of Education announced at Monday’s meeting its unanimous decision to hire Fred Hunter, the news was greeted by enthusiastic applause and a standing ovation.

Request for firm to check residency in District 161 falls short
Flossmoor School District 161 school board members this week failed to approve the proposed hiring of a firm to verify the residency of students and improve the registration process. After election, three new District 161 board members eye change
Change is coming to Flossmoor District 161 after voters decided April 4 that Carolyn Griggs, Cameron Nelson and Misha Blackman will be new school board members.
